Irish abroad on Election 2020: ‘My mother understands why I would choose not to come back’


Most are unable to vote, as Irish citizens lose their right if they have lived outside the State for more than 18 months. We asked Irish people living abroad what issues are concerning them. Although I stayed abroad through personal choice this was definitely a reason I was “put off” moving home. For a long time my mother felt very hurt and confused as to why I would choose to stay abroad. John Spillane, Sydney: ‘Is it time for a national conversation on what it means to be an Irish citizen?’Why do Irish citizens abroad not have full voting rights (as do citizens of USA, Canada, Australia)?
